APERIO, Music of the Americas Presents
a special streaming performance of PHILIP GLASS’
AGUAS DA AMAZONIA for Chamber orchestra
Inspired by the Amazon River and its tributaries, Philip Glass' monumental Aguas da Amazonia explores a vivid mixture of orchestral and percussive textures in the composer's signature style. Aperio performed the North American premiere of Aguas da Amazonia in 2017 to critical acclaim. Houstonia magazine praised the premiere as "a welcome flood of technical ambition" and Arts+CultureTX lauded Aperio's performance as "ebullient, vibrant...and riveting throughout."
Experience the grandeur of this monumental work for chamber orchestra in a live streamed reprise performance filmed on stage at Miller Outdoor Theatre in Houston, TX in June of 2019. Maestro Marlon Chen (Manila Symphony Orchestra, MDR Orchestra Leipzig, Orchestre de Paris) conducts.
